Youth Vibes

若者向けのお役立ちブログ

MENU

大学生のためのプログラミング学習ガイド:メリット、勉強方法、初心者向けおすすめ言語

 


はじめに

大学生の皆さん、こんにちは!近年、プログラミングの重要性がますます高まっています。特に大学生にとって、プログラミングを学ぶことは将来のキャリアや個人の成長に大きな影響を与えることがあります。本記事では、大学生がプログラミングを学ぶメリットと効果的な勉強方法、そして初心者におすすめの言語について詳しく解説します。プログラミングに興味を持っている初心者の方々にとって、貴重な情報が詰まった記事となっていますので、ぜひ最後までお読みください!

↓合わせて読みたい↓

youthvibes.hatenablog.com

 

1. プログラミングを学ぶメリット

プログラミングを学ぶことには、多くのメリットがあります。特に大学生にとっては、将来のキャリアに役立つだけでなく、個人的なスキルや能力の向上にもつながります。

1-1. キャリアの選択肢が広がる

プログラミングスキルを持つことで、さまざまな職業の選択肢が広がります。ソフトウェアエンジニアやウェブデベロッパーはもちろんのこと、データサイエンティストやAIエンジニアとしても活躍できます。

1-2. 副業やフリーランス活動が可能に

プログラミングのスキルを活かして、副業やフリーランスとしての活動が可能です。ウェブ開発やアプリ開発などの案件を受けることで、自分のスキルを活かして収入を得ることができます。

1-3. 問題解決能力や論理思考力が養われる

プログラミングは論理的思考や問題解決能力を鍛えるのに最適です。コードを書く際には、複雑な問題を細かく分解し、論理的な手順で解決する能力が必要です。

1-4. 自己表現やアイデアの実現が可能に

プログラミングを学ぶことで、自分のアイデアや概念を具体的な形にすることができます。ウェブサイトやアプリケーションを作成することで、自分の才能やアイデアを世界に発信することができます

1-5. 成果物が即時にフィードバックされる

プログラミングをすると、コードを書いた結果が即座に反映されます。そのため、自分の成果をすぐに確認できるため、学習のモチベーションを維持しやすくなります。

 

2. プログラミングを学ぶための効果的な勉強方法

プログラミングを学ぶためには、効果的な勉強方法が重要です。以下では、初心者におすすめの勉強方法を紹介します。

2-1. オンラインコースチュートリアルの利用

オンラインには、多くの無料や有料のプログラミングコースやチュートリアルがあります。自分のスケジュールに合わせて学習できるので、効率的にスキルを磨くことができます。UdemyやCourseraなどのプラットフォームを活用して、自分のペースで学習を進めることができます。

2-2. 実践的なプロジェクトに取り組む

理論だけでなく、実際にプロジェクトを作成することで、実践的なスキルを身に付けることができます。小さなアプリケーションやウェブサイトを作成してみましょう

2-3. コミュニティに参加する

オンラインや地元のコミュニティに参加することで、他の学習者やプロの開発者と交流することができます。質問や意見交換を通じて、学習を加速させることができます。

2-4. 定期的な練習を行う

プログラミングは習得に時間がかかるものです。定期的に練習を続けることで、スキルを着実に向上させることができます。毎日少しずつでも構いませんので、継続することが大切です。

2-5. 学習の記録を残す

学習の過程や成果を記録することで、自分の成長を実感することができます。ブログやSNSなどで自分の学びや作品を公開し、他の人と共有しましょう。

 

3. 初心者におすすめのプログラミング言語

初心者がプログラミングを学ぶ際には、学習しやすくて幅広い用途に使える言語を選ぶことが重要です。以下は、初心者におすすめのプログラミング言語です。

3-1. Python

Pythonは初心者にとって非常に人気のある言語です。シンプルで読みやすい構文を持ち、さまざまな用途に使えるため、幅広い分野で活躍しています。

3-2. JavaScript

JavaScriptウェブ開発に不可欠な言語です。ブラウザ上で動的なコンテンツやインタラクティブな機能を実装するために使用されます。

3-3. Java

Javaオブジェクト指向プログラミングの基礎を学ぶのに適した言語です。また、Androidアプリ開発にも使用されています。

3-4. Ruby

Rubyはシンプルで読みやすい構文を持つ言語であり、初心者にも親しみやすいです。WebアプリケーションフレームワークであるRuby on Railsも人気があります。

これらの言語は、初心者がプログラミングを学ぶにあたって優れた選択肢です。興味や目標に合わせて言語を選び、積極的に学習に取り組んでください。

まとめ

今回は、大学生がプログラミングを学ぶメリットと効果的な勉強方法、そして初心者におすすめのプログラミング言語について紹介しました。プログラミングは将来のキャリアや個人の成長に大きく貢献することができる重要なスキルです。ぜひ、興味を持って取り組み、自分の可能性を広げるための一歩を踏み出してください!

MENU